This print captures a pivotal moment in history - Stanley's Expedition in search of Livingstone. The image showcases the determination and bravery of Henry Morton Stanley as he embarks on his journey through Africa, armed with rifles and accompanied by a team of porters. The iconic pith helmet worn by Stanley serves as a symbol of exploration and adventure during this historical expedition.
The year 1871 marked a significant chapter in the annals of exploration, as Stanley set out to find the renowned missionary and explorer, Livingstone. This photograph immortalizes the events that unfolded during this daring quest, shedding light on the challenges faced by early explorers in uncharted territories.
